新聞中心

EEPW首頁(yè) > 嵌入式系統(tǒng) > 設(shè)計(jì)應(yīng)用 > 基于單片機(jī)的電氣控制線路接線故障診斷系統(tǒng)

基于單片機(jī)的電氣控制線路接線故障診斷系統(tǒng)

作者: 時(shí)間:2010-09-23 來(lái)源:網(wǎng)絡(luò) 收藏

2.2 節(jié)點(diǎn)切換矩陣工作原理
表1中各電器元件的樁(即節(jié)點(diǎn))均用導(dǎo)線連接至節(jié)點(diǎn)切換矩陣的微型繼電器,通過(guò)繼電器把節(jié)點(diǎn)和檢測(cè)總線(分為主總線和從總線)相連通。時(shí),讀取網(wǎng)絡(luò)表的數(shù)據(jù)(如表2中的0111H),將高位(01H)由P1口送至譯碼電路1譯碼后,相應(yīng)繼電器吸合,使對(duì)應(yīng)的01號(hào)節(jié)點(diǎn)(電源接線柱的1號(hào)接線樁)與主總線接通;同時(shí)將低位(11H)由P2口送至譯碼電路2譯碼后,相應(yīng)繼電器吸合,使對(duì)應(yīng)的11號(hào)節(jié)點(diǎn)(交流接觸器KM1的1號(hào)接線樁)與從總線接通。主總線接至的P3.3,從總線接至P3.4,由判別主從總線間也就是電源接線柱的1號(hào)接線樁與交流接觸器KM1的1號(hào)接線樁之間有無(wú)接線。只要把表1中的節(jié)點(diǎn)編碼依次由P2口發(fā)出,即可檢測(cè)01號(hào)節(jié)點(diǎn)與其他節(jié)點(diǎn)的接線情況。所以,通過(guò)節(jié)點(diǎn)切換矩陣可以檢測(cè)任意兩個(gè)節(jié)點(diǎn)之間有無(wú)接線,再把檢測(cè)結(jié)果與正確接線的節(jié)點(diǎn)網(wǎng)絡(luò)表進(jìn)行比較,即可得出錯(cuò)誤接線的位置,也可據(jù)此進(jìn)行評(píng)分。
P3.2為節(jié)點(diǎn)切換矩陣的使能,當(dāng)檢測(cè)結(jié)束后,P3.2使節(jié)點(diǎn)切換矩陣無(wú)效,所有繼電器釋放,使檢測(cè)電路和電機(jī)完全隔離,不受電機(jī)通電試驗(yàn)的影響。
2.3 主從總線間有無(wú)接線的檢測(cè)原理
從總線通過(guò)1 kΩ電阻接地,單片機(jī)由P3.3向主總線發(fā)出1 MHz的方波(10101010即AAH),如果主從總線間有導(dǎo)線連接,則P3.4讀取的數(shù)據(jù)也是AAH;如果主從總線間無(wú)導(dǎo)線連接,則P3.4讀取的數(shù)據(jù)為00H。若P3.4讀取的數(shù)據(jù)為其他值則說(shuō)明主從總線間有導(dǎo)線連接但接觸不良,將其標(biāo)記為FFH。所以從P3.4讀取的數(shù)據(jù)反映出連接在主從總線間的兩個(gè)節(jié)點(diǎn)的接線情況。例如檢測(cè)節(jié)點(diǎn)0111時(shí),如果01節(jié)點(diǎn)和11節(jié)點(diǎn)之間有導(dǎo)線連接,則檢測(cè)結(jié)果為0111AAH;若無(wú)導(dǎo)線連接則檢測(cè)結(jié)果為011100H;若接觸不良則檢測(cè)結(jié)果為0111FFH。檢測(cè)結(jié)果發(fā)送給管理計(jì)算機(jī),管理軟件用圖形方式還原接線板實(shí)際接線的情況并標(biāo)注出錯(cuò)誤所在。
2.4 題號(hào)識(shí)別電路工作原理
每張題卡為一個(gè)訓(xùn)練項(xiàng)目,上面印著該項(xiàng)目的控制原理圖及接線要求。每個(gè)訓(xùn)練項(xiàng)目的題卡有惟一的編號(hào)。題卡內(nèi)隱藏3個(gè)磁片,當(dāng)題卡插入接線板上的題卡框內(nèi)時(shí),對(duì)應(yīng)磁片位置的干簧管動(dòng)作,將題卡編號(hào)輸入單片機(jī)的P3.5,P3.6,P3.7,單片機(jī)查找對(duì)應(yīng)的節(jié)點(diǎn)網(wǎng)絡(luò)表并以此為依據(jù)檢測(cè)接線是否正確。

3 接線的軟件設(shè)計(jì)
控制接線故障的軟件分為單片機(jī)程序和計(jì)算機(jī)管理軟件兩部分。
單片機(jī)程序的主要功能如下:
(1)控制接線板的電源,有允許通電和禁止通電兩種狀態(tài),通過(guò)相應(yīng)的指示燈作指引。只有診斷無(wú)故障才允許通電,其余時(shí)間禁止通電。
(2)檢測(cè)題卡號(hào),未插題卡時(shí)禁止通電,按下診斷按鈕時(shí)檢測(cè)所有節(jié)點(diǎn)的接線情況,有故障指示燈閃亮。已插題卡時(shí)檢測(cè)題卡號(hào)并查找對(duì)應(yīng)的節(jié)點(diǎn)網(wǎng)絡(luò)表,按下診斷按鈕時(shí)檢測(cè)所有節(jié)點(diǎn)的接線情況,將檢測(cè)結(jié)果與節(jié)點(diǎn)網(wǎng)絡(luò)表進(jìn)行比較,相符時(shí)點(diǎn)亮無(wú)故障指示燈,允許通電;不相符時(shí)點(diǎn)亮有故障指示燈,禁止通電。無(wú)論何時(shí),當(dāng)檢測(cè)結(jié)束后均釋放節(jié)點(diǎn)切換矩陣的所有繼電器并將其鎖定。
(3)按下提交按鈕時(shí),若還未診斷則先診斷,然后將接線板號(hào)、題卡號(hào)、診斷結(jié)果的數(shù)據(jù)發(fā)送給管理計(jì)算機(jī)。發(fā)送成功則點(diǎn)亮提交狀態(tài)指示燈,若接線板不在線或數(shù)據(jù)發(fā)送失敗則提交狀態(tài)指示燈閃亮。
計(jì)算機(jī)管理軟件的主要功能如下:
(1)班級(jí)、名單、實(shí)訓(xùn)成績(jī)管理。
(2)實(shí)訓(xùn)板在線狀態(tài)指示、提交狀態(tài)指示、接線時(shí)間計(jì)時(shí)。
(3)接收接線板提交的數(shù)據(jù),顯示題卡號(hào)和正確的原理圖及接線圖,重現(xiàn)接線板實(shí)際的原理圖和接線圖,標(biāo)注錯(cuò)誤的接線。
(4)根據(jù)實(shí)際接線的錯(cuò)誤數(shù)量及錯(cuò)誤程度自動(dòng)評(píng)分,評(píng)分結(jié)果自動(dòng)錄入成績(jī)單。
(5)技能鑒定考試時(shí)自動(dòng)發(fā)題(把考生抽取的題號(hào)自動(dòng)發(fā)送至接線板),考試結(jié)束后控制接線板自動(dòng)進(jìn)行診斷并提交結(jié)果,生成考評(píng)成績(jī)。

4 智能化控制實(shí)訓(xùn)室的構(gòu)成
智能化電氣控制實(shí)訓(xùn)室由管理計(jì)算機(jī)(簡(jiǎn)稱教師機(jī))、學(xué)生實(shí)訓(xùn)臺(tái)組成,電氣控制線路接線板安裝在實(shí)訓(xùn)臺(tái)上,通過(guò)RS 485總線與教師機(jī)聯(lián)網(wǎng)。電氣控制實(shí)訓(xùn)室的網(wǎng)絡(luò)拓?fù)浣Y(jié)構(gòu)如圖3所示。

本文引用地址:http://m.butianyuan.cn/article/173208.htm


智能化電氣控制實(shí)訓(xùn)室的使用有三種模式:基本訓(xùn)練時(shí)接線板可不聯(lián)網(wǎng),學(xué)生接線后由接線故障診斷替代教師進(jìn)行檢查,有故障時(shí)學(xué)生自行檢測(cè)直至故障排除;綜合訓(xùn)練時(shí)接線板聯(lián)網(wǎng),學(xué)生將結(jié)果提交給教師,有故障時(shí)由教師引導(dǎo)學(xué)生進(jìn)行排除,同時(shí)計(jì)時(shí)并評(píng)分;技能考評(píng)時(shí)接線板聯(lián)網(wǎng),教師發(fā)題后開(kāi)始接線并計(jì)時(shí),考試時(shí)間到,由教師機(jī)對(duì)還未提交的考生強(qiáng)制診斷并提交,及時(shí)打印、公布考評(píng)成績(jī)且能指出接線錯(cuò)誤所在及扣分情況,實(shí)現(xiàn)智能考評(píng),確保技能考評(píng)的公平與公正。

5結(jié)語(yǔ)
電氣控制線路接線故障診斷系統(tǒng)以及智能化電氣控制實(shí)訓(xùn)室,以其準(zhǔn)確、快捷、高效的性能,提高了教學(xué)效果和教學(xué)效率。對(duì)促進(jìn)學(xué)生學(xué)習(xí)主動(dòng)性、減輕教師教學(xué)負(fù)擔(dān)、確??荚u(píng)的公平與公正等方面有著積極意義。


上一頁(yè) 1 2 下一頁(yè)

評(píng)論


相關(guān)推薦

技術(shù)專區(qū)

關(guān)閉